The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of George Potter, born in 1848 in Lynn, Norfolk, consisted of 7 members. George was the head of the household, married to Sarah Potter, born in 1849 in Essex, England. They had 3 children; Ernest (born 1874 in Stratford, Essex, England), May (born 1875 in Stratford, Essex, England) and Daisy (born 1879 in Bow, Middlesex, England).
During the period, also present in the household were George's Cousin, Frank (born 1868 in Middlesex, England) and George's Servant, Jane (born 1867 in Essex, England).
